Output 20dfa257706f23ecdf53c3b431f425ea859a570dcb174395b38632b225dee16e:3

value
4770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85641a70b83362bb08b4113689fde55497e2cf1 OP_EQUAL
address
3MQuDBYqvutH4iPb9qEaUeEigqAwReLGkD
transaction
20dfa257706f23ecdf53c3b431f425ea859a570dcb174395b38632b225dee16e
spent
true